About Atua

Atua is a macOS assistant built around reusable commands rather than a chat window. You write a prompt once, attach the context it should pull in — selected text, screenshots, clipboard, voice transcript, window content, or screen OCR — assign it a hotkey and an output mode, and then run it from inside whatever app you are already in. The result is that Atua does things rather than only answering: commands can write back into the app, trigger tools, and chain multiple actions. Context references work as template variables, so a command can say review this PR diff and post comments via GitHub MCP against {{selectedText}}. It ships built-in system tools for Calendar, Reminders, Notes, Finder, Shortcuts, Shell, and HTTP, so it can read and write native Mac apps directly, and it connects external MCP servers — GitHub, Postgres, Slack, filesystem, and anything else you add — for use inside any command. Voice input runs locally on the Mac, for both dictation and Voice Paste. The privacy stance is unusually strict for this category: no accounts, no analytics, and data stays on the machine, with the model calls going out under your own API key. It is sold as a $29 one-time lifetime license with a 7-day money-back guarantee.

Atua Pros & Cons

Pros

  • +$29 lifetime with no subscription and no account at all
  • +MCP support plus native Mac tools makes it an automation layer, not just a chat box
  • +Bring-your-own-key means you pay provider rates rather than a marked-up seat price
  • +Genuinely private by construction — no analytics and no server-side account

⚠️ Cons

  • macOS only
  • BYOK means setting up and funding a provider account before it works
  • Command-authoring model has a learning curve versus just typing into a chat
  • Shell and MCP tool access grants broad power to a prompt-driven system
